Closest airport to saint augustine florida.

Northeast Florida Regional Airport (UST) is a mere 10-minute drive to St. Augustine or Ponte Vedra for those traveling on private planes. Jacksonville International Airport (JAX) is approximately 50 minutes north of St. Augustine and 30 minutes from Ponte Vedra.

Welcome to Northeast Florida Regional Airport. Northeast Florida Regional Airport is located just a few miles from historic downtown St. Augustine and serves as a key connection point for air travel in Northeast Florida. The airport is centered in a gateway market of 4.4 million passengers within a 2-hour drive to the facility. The nearest major airport is St Augustine (UST). This airport has domestic flights and is 5 miles from the center of Saint Augustine, FL. Another major airport is Jacksonville International Airport (JAX / KJAX), which has international and domestic flights from Jacksonville, Florida and is 51 miles from Saint Augustine, FL. Northeast Florida Regional Airport (UST): 5 Miles. St. Augustine, FL (UST) is a small airport located just a few miles from the city centre. While the airport is the closest airport to St. Augustine, it may not offer as many flights as larger airports like Jacksonville International Airport, it is still a convenient option for travellers visiting St. Augustine for several reasons.
